Output d8b2632644ddc68b9dbeaacd7ed56c7cc17493fb85dcecfd8f9df97bfeeede70:29

value
2690963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22243701326e731cc3ae99ed3067871eb7eab7fb OP_EQUAL
address
34oYHKSQXo58QY1kDrVwWiGPXL2BoKxLKV
transaction
d8b2632644ddc68b9dbeaacd7ed56c7cc17493fb85dcecfd8f9df97bfeeede70
spent
true